Watson's Five Touchdown Day Leads Bobcats Past #8 Cougars

CHICAGO, IL. (September 14, 2024) – The St. Thomas University (STU) football team soared to victory in a thrilling clash against the #8 Saint Xavier Cougars, overcoming a late surge to secure a decisive 33-14 win. Led by a stellar performance from quarterback Keely Watson and the run game, the Bobcats executed a well-orchestrated game plan to outlast the Cougars.

The game kicked off with the Bobcats making an immediate statement. On their opening drive, the Bobcats showcased their offensive prowess as Keely Watson connected with David Hayes for a 34-yard touchdown pass. The drive, consisting of six plays for 80 yards, giving St. Thomas an early 6-0 lead after the point after attempt was blocked. Continuing their strong offensive showing, the Bobcats doubled their lead in the second quarter. Watson once again found a target in the end zone, this time delivering an 11-yard pass to Khalitri Zow. The drive spanned six plays and covered 56 yards, demonstrating the Bobcats' effective ball control and ability to capitalize on opportunities.

STU kept the pressure on, and with just under six minutes remaining in the second quarter, Watson and Hayes struck again. Hayes caught a 25-yard pass from Watson, leading to a successful extra point kick by Zachary Alvarez. The score ballooned to 19-0 as St. Thomas continued to build their lead nearing the end of the first half. Not content with a comfortable margin, the Bobcats capped off an impressive first half with another touchdown. Watson's 17-yard pass to Jaden Fox-Harrington was a highlight of an 11-play, 77-yard drive that ate up nearly four minutes of clock. The successful Geno Lubin pass for the extra point extended St. Thomas' lead to a commanding 27-0 with just over a minute left in the second quarter.

The Cougars, however, were not ready to go down without a fight. SXU managed to respond just before halftime. Stuart Ross connected with Brandt Hixson for an 18-yard touchdown pass, and with Peyton Benes adding the extra point, SXU reduced the deficit to 27-7. The drive was quick and efficient, covering 43 yards in just two plays. As the second half unfolded, the Bobcats remained resilient, with both teams battling for control. SXU made a push early in the fourth quarter as Ross found Ronnie Foster for a 19-yard touchdown pass. Benes's successful kick brought the Cougars closer at 27-14, injecting a sense of urgency into the final moments of the game.

However, the Bobcats answered back with a crucial score to put the game out of reach. Watson connected with Jaelyn Thomas for a 16-yard touchdown pass. Although Rontavious Farmer's rush attempt failed, the score reached 33-14 with just over eight minutes remaining. The Bobcats' defense held firm for the rest of the game, securing the victory.
